Bonjour,
J'essaie de développer un réseau de routes et son traffic.
Pour se faire j'ai pensé deux graphe : G1 et G2.
G1 étant un graphe non orienté (en vert sur le shéma) qui servirait uniquement à l'affichage des routes (splines, etc....)
G2 étant un graphe orienté (sommets en noir et arêtes en bleu) qui servirait pour pour un algorithme de pathfinding genre A*.
Est ce la meilleure façon de procéder sachant que G1 contiendra maximum 5000 sommets et 8 arêtes adjacentes par sommet et G2 contiendra maximum 5000 x 9= 45000 sommets et 7 arêtes adjacentes par sommet.
Dois-je utiliser deux graphes indépendants ? Ou est ce plus propre d'utiliser un graphe et son sous-graphe ?
Partager